Catechol-Chitosan-Hydroxyapatite Composite Technology

This technology relates to a composite combining hydroxyapatite, a chitosan-based polymer, and catechol-based components to improve both mechanical strength and biocompatibility.

Conventional composite materials for bone regeneration have had difficulty balancing strength and biocompatibility. This technology forms an organically reinforced composition by combining hydroxyapatite with chitosan derivatives and catechol derivatives.

As a result, it can simultaneously improve mechanical strength and biocompatibility, making it useful in bone regeneration, tissue engineering, and medical composite materials.




Key Features:

  • It combines hydroxyapatite, chitosan or a derivative thereof, and catechol or a derivative thereof.
  • It is advantageous for improving mechanical strength and biocompatibility in the form of an organically reinforced composition.
  • It is suitable for bone regeneration and medical composite-material applications.
